A Hotel Executive Chef is responsible for overseeing the entire culinary operation of a hotel, ensuring high-quality food, menu innovation, and efficient kitchen management. Whether you are an aspiring chef or an experienced culinary professional, understanding the Hotel Executive Chef job description is essential for success.
A Hotel Executive Chef is the head of the kitchen and plays a crucial role in a hotel's dining experience. They lead the kitchen staff, create menus, and ensure that all food preparation meets the highest quality standards.
The primary duties of an Executive Chef in a hotel include:
Menu Planning & Development – Designing innovative and appealing menus that cater to diverse guests.
Food Preparation & Presentation – Ensuring dishes are prepared to perfection and presented attractively.
Kitchen Management – Overseeing kitchen operations, maintaining cleanliness, and ensuring compliance with safety regulations.
Budgeting & Cost Control – Managing food costs, controlling waste, and ensuring profitability.
Staff Training & Leadership – Hiring, training, and supervising kitchen staff to maintain high culinary standards.
Collaboration with Other Departments – Working closely with food and beverage managers and catering teams to align services.
Customer Satisfaction – Addressing guest feedback and ensuring a memorable dining experience.
To excel in Hotel Executive Chef jobs, candidates typically need a combination of education, experience, and culinary expertise.
A degree or diploma in Culinary Arts or Hospitality Management.
Certifications such as Certified Executive Chef (CEC) or Certified Master Chef (CMC).
A minimum of 5-10 years of experience in professional kitchens, with at least a few years in a leadership role.
Experience in multiple cuisines and catering is a plus.
Leadership & Team Management – Ability to lead and inspire kitchen staff.
Creativity & Innovation – Developing unique dishes and adapting to food trends.
Financial Acumen – Managing budgets and optimizing cost-efficiency.
Time Management & Multitasking – Handling mult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ment.
Attention to Detail – Ensuring quality and consistency in every dish.

A Sales and Catering Manager is responsible for driving revenue through event planning, catering sales, and client relations. This role requires a blend of hospitality expertise and sales acumen to secure bookings for corporate events, weddings, and banquets.
Event Sales & Coordination – Handling inquiries, negotiating contracts, and planning event details.
Client Relationship Management – Building and maintaining relationships with clients to encourage repeat business.
Revenue Management – Developing pricing strategies and maximizing catering sales.
Collaboration with Kitchen & Service Teams – Ensuring seamless execution of events.
Marketing & Promotion – Creating promotional campaigns to attract clients.
